About University Health
University Health is a nationally recognized academic health system with a more than 100-year history of serving South Texas and is the primary teaching partner of UT Health San Antonio. We are committed to clinical excellence, innovation, education, and improving the health of our community.
Growth & Expansion
University Health is in the midst of the largest expansion in its history, highlighted by the development of two new full-service hospitals that will enhance access to specialty, inpatient, emergency, and diagnostic services. These new facilities will support continued growth of interventional radiology services across the system.
